package dr.evomodel.branchratemodel;
import dr.evolution.tree.NodeRef;
import dr.evolution.tree.Tree;
import dr.evomodelxml.branchratemodel.StrictClockBranchRatesParser;
import dr.inference.model.Model;
import dr.inference.model.Parameter;
import dr.inference.model.Variable;
/**
* @author Alexei Drummond
* @author Andrew Rambaut
* @version $Id: StrictClockBranchRates.java,v 1.3 2006/01/09 17:44:30 rambaut Exp $
*/
public class StrictClockBranchRates extends AbstractBranchRateModel {
private final Parameter rateParameter;
public StrictClockBranchRates(Parameter rateParameter) {
super(StrictClockBranchRatesParser.STRICT_CLOCK_BRANCH_RATES);
this.rateParameter = rateParameter;
addVariable(rateParameter);
}
public void handleModelChangedEvent(Model model, Object object, int index) {
// nothing to do
}
protected final void handleVariableChangedEvent(Variable variable, int index, Parameter.ChangeType type) {
fireModelChanged();
}
protected void storeState() {
// nothing to do
}
protected void restoreState() {
// nothing to do
}
protected void acceptState() {
// nothing to do
}
public double getBranchRate(final Tree tree, final NodeRef node) {
return rateParameter.getParameterValue(0);
}
}
